你查询的IP:[159.226.109.67]  地理位置:中国–北京–北京科技网

最新查询114.54.20.51 123.52.22.6 123.178.90.111 202.127.107.211 117.112.143.10 221.14.139.129 218.64.132.99 116.116.19.138 123.101.38.6 159.226.109.67 124.108.8.228 219.216.113.101 60.194.48.164 202.14.236.235 123.99.128.162 118.132.207.45 116.90.184.241 114.54.29.145 203.212.72.112 117.120.64.44 119.10.149.172 222.32.162.80 121.52.160.122 203.156.192.11 202.14.88.129 202.143.16.155 120.48.103.160 117.100.138.175 202.127.212.23 124.220.44.132 124.47.137.54